That did made me curious.
After getting a simular pxelinux.cfg as above, I did get
| Booting...
| Invalid ELF file or insufficient memory
| boot:
Due the succes report from HPA,
I knew there is something wrong with my setup.
After replacing pxelinux.0 with a newer one.
(in fact making a better match of 'elf.c32' and 'pxelinux.0' version wise )
is 'Booting...' immediate follow-up with a complete black screen
for about five seconds ( 900MHz Intel Pentium III ) and the text
| Initalized console on port CONSOLE
|
|
|
| *** HELLO WORLD TEST ***
| Hello World
| *** END OF HELLO WORLD TEST ***
|
| EXECUTIVE SHUTDOWN! Any key to reboot...
in a new screen. Hitting a key indeed reboots.
It was interresting to see 'elf.c32' working, especial the logging
in the TFTP server where the fetch of elf.c32 immediate was followed
with hello.exe.
